Job description
The Chronic Disease Nurse Coordinator works closely with the Manager of Clinical Integration Primary Health Care. The Chronic Disease Nurse Coordinator is an expert clinical nurse who will be working closely with the programs within Clinical Integration Unit 1 (this includes specialties of Diabetes, COPD and asthma, Intermediate Care Services, etc). In collaboration with Primary Health Care (PHC) colleagues, the Chronic Disease Nurse Educator is responsible for providing clinical supervision of staff, orientation, certification, continuing education, assisting in the development of clinical pathways, and participating in development of policies and procedures relating to general and specialty chronic conditions care. The incumbent will participate in program planning and evaluation. Primary responsibilities include ensuring services follow the Diabetes Canada Clinical Practice Guidelines, Canadian Thoracic Society Guidelines, etc.
Experience
- Minimum 1 year supervisory experience
- five (5) years' recent nursing experience in Diabetes and Respiratory education
Education
- Bachelor of Science in Nursing (BScN)
Memberships
- College of Registered Nurses of Saskatchewan (CRNS)
Other Education & Training
- RN special practice for insulin dose adjustment training
- Certified Diabetes Educator...
